Output e76b6837f6d0bb18ba4f1867273f16394087cfc9031375a70a652fa393383b76:4

value
1558252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852fb6fbc08a96537eec33cc481debc66b782835 OP_EQUAL
address
3DqExLZprSxXxjtTNWW95VBh5rKZk7wrDk
transaction
e76b6837f6d0bb18ba4f1867273f16394087cfc9031375a70a652fa393383b76
spent
true